Pakistan

The governor of the NWFP wants to negotiate with the Taliban in North Waziristan. Seven soldiers and 15 Taliban were killed in clashes in North Waziristan and Dera Ismail Khan. Tribal elders in Khyber Agency want to negotiate with the Taliban. An IED attack killed a tribal elder in Bajaur. A fatwa was issued against friends of the US and Jews in Swat. More troops are being deployed to Kurram agency to block routes for the operation in Tora Bora in Afghanistan. A “mob” attacked a police station in Quetta; two police were shot and two Taliban were freed. The Lal Masjid will reopen on August 20.
